Я пытаюсь развернуть приложение Node.js на облачной платформе Google, но обнаруживаю ошибку с MongoDB - PullRequest
0 голосов
/ 14 января 2020

Я создал приложение Node.js и теперь мне нужно развернуть его в Google Cloud Compute Engine. Как было показано в руководстве, я создал новый проект в GSP, затем я скачал GSP SDK и создал app.yaml со следующим кодом:

#[START app.yaml]
runtime: nodejs
env: flex

Затем я запустил gcloud app deploy и получил следующую ошибку:

name: 'MongoError',
message: 
 'failed to connect to server [localhost:27017] on first connect' 
Error: KeystoneJS (seebelarus.by) failed to start - Check that you are running 'mongod' in a separate process.

Итак, что мне нужно сделать, чтобы исправить эту ошибку?

1 Ответ

0 голосов
/ 14 января 2020

То есть он пытается подключиться к Mon go локально. Был ли в вашем руководстве шаг, возможно, для настройки сервера Mon go?

Я предполагаю, что вам нужно создать сервер Mon go и обновить строку подключения, чтобы указать местоположение этого человека, в отличие от localhost.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...